Javascript get()在我的例子中jquery没有定义
我没有定义,我不知道为什么。我试图不解析html,而是使用字符串来搜索我的id,这是所有的票证,它也不起作用。有什么想法吗Javascript get()在我的例子中jquery没有定义,javascript,jquery,Javascript,Jquery,我没有定义,我不知道为什么。我试图不解析html,而是使用字符串来搜索我的id,这是所有的票证,它也不起作用。有什么想法吗 我还尝试了$(数据),不起作用:(这似乎是一个数组,您正试图用$.parseHTML()解析xml内容。相反,您必须尝试创建一个循环,或者只是将内容附加到div和中。find()所需的元素: var wrapper = $('<div/>', { html:data.join('') }); console.log(wrapper.find('#all
我还尝试了
$(数据)
,不起作用:(这似乎是一个数组,您正试图用$.parseHTML()
解析xml
内容。相反,您必须尝试创建一个循环,或者只是将内容附加到div和中。find()
所需的元素:
var wrapper = $('<div/>', {
html:data.join('')
});
console.log(wrapper.find('#all-tickets')[0]);
var wrapper=$(“”{
html:data.join(“”)
});
console.log(wrapper.find('#all tickets')[0]);
查看示例演示:
var arr=['text',''targetDiv'];
var div=$('',{html:arr.join('')});
$(document.body).append(div.find(“#targetDiv”)[0]);
您没有得到未定义的结果。请放入console.log(elem.html())并进行检查。@ParthTrivedi尝试过,我得到了未定义的检查Dombreakpoints@Satpal上面是我的console.log(数据);尝试使用var elem=$(数据)。查找(“#所有票据”)[0];
。执行console.log($(数据)。查找(“#所有票据”)的结果是什么
?我能不解析它吗?我不懂你的代码。我只想得到html块#所有的票子看到结果是一个数组
而不是xml/html/xhtml
,数组有索引,所以你不能对它们使用。find()
。@Jennifer检查一下这个片段,如果这有帮助的话。你知道它为什么是数组吗?
var wrapper = $('<div/>', {
html:data.join('')
});
console.log(wrapper.find('#all-tickets')[0]);